760 SAT to ACT Equivalent Conversion

Colleges use concordance tables to compare SAT and ACT scores. The following table shows the 760 SAT to ACT equivalent and nearby scores for context. These conversions are approximate.

SAT Score ACT Equivalent
700 12
720 12
740 13
760 13
780 14
800 14
820 14

Individual colleges may interpret scores slightly differently, so treat concordance as a guide rather than an exact rule.
